Technical range
Senior Software Engineer
David Hook
Production software across SaaS, AI, commerce, browser extensions, and desktop tools.
I build practical products end to end: TypeScript SaaS platforms, Chrome extensions, native C++/JUCE audio tools, Laravel and React systems, and long-running commerce platforms.
Current Focus
Current work is product systems, not just websites
Recent GitHub activity is centred on full-stack SaaS products, privacy/security extensions, native audio software, and AI-assisted commerce tooling.
Flagship Work
Strongest recent public projects
These are the projects I would lead with today: deployed product architecture, Chrome extension products, privacy tooling, native audio software, and AI media workflows.
Platform Delivery
Commerce platforms with delivery behind the logos
Partner and platform work across Adobe Commerce, Shopify, OpenCart, WooCommerce, and custom PHP systems, supported by newer product work such as WooOracle AI.
Commercial Website Work
Commercial delivery across agencies and production sites
The newer GitHub products sit on top of a long commercial base: CMS builds, e-commerce, reservations, multilingual sites, search, content management, and performance work.
GitHub Archive
Public repositories grouped by problem type
The archive is regenerated from GitHub metadata so the page stays close to current work without adding a heavy runtime integration.
Experience
Senior engineering with a product-builder edge
Senior Software Engineer with 20+ years experience building, maintaining, and scaling production systems across agency, in-house, freelance, and independent product work.
How I work
Open to the right projects
Need someone who can ship product code and understand the commercial reality around it?
I can help with SaaS builds, Laravel and React products, Chrome extensions, AI workflows, native audio tooling, commerce platform work, and careful modernisation of existing systems.